Verra Mobility is a global leader in smart mobility. Verra Mobility Commercial Services creates smart roadways, serving the world's largest commercial fleets and rental car companies to manage tolling transactions and violations for more than 8.5 million vehicles. Verra Mobility is a leading provider of connected systems, processing nearly 165 million transactions each year through connectivity with more than 50 individual tolling authorities and more than 400 issuing authorities. Arizona-based Verra Mobility Corp. currently operates in 15 countries and in 22 languages.

Position Overview

Own and champion the SW Quality as the Engineering leader in the Verra Mobility CS Business. Provide Operating Standards and tools, testing, infrastructure for development and deployment of Cloud based Data processing solutions and services for Connected Fleets. Our existing team of domain experts and high-quality experienced engineers form a great team environment. We are looking for the best of the best leaders who want to challenge themselves in a fast moving yet a disciplined environment. The leadership role is the critical link across development, testing, staging, provisioning, deployment, and technical support enabling and supporting friction-free collaboration

Essential Responsibilities

1. Leadership/management role which builds, enhances, and supports the life cycle from a concept to deployment of software with the Design-In Quality principle.

2. Leads adoption and adherence to the Stage Gate process with Lean Agile SW development

3. Champion the product quality assurance for software and services with ’TQM – Total Quality Management’

i. Management of the Quality Assurance and Quality/Test engineering resources

4. Own the technology and engineering collaboration with tools and systems for Software builds, integration, release engineering:

i. Maintain and verify the software releases – Integration Test, System Test, UAT, Production Validation

ii. QA/QE to conduct performance testing early & often.

iii. Test Automation

5. Leads software product engineering with Continuous Integration and Continuous deployment objective

i. Build and maintain R&D Software product design, build tools and agile software integration tools

ii. Continuous Integration / Build Automation infrastructure (app servers, databases, agents, etc…).

iii. SW Configuration Management and SW artifact repository: Own and govern the source code repositories and branches and respective configuration management

6. Communicate and evangelize process and data driven approach for quality thru product development life cycle including software builds, integration, and release engineering

Verra Mobility is an Arizona-based smart transportation company that provides violation processing, traffic and toll management solutions for businesses.
